Which forms or schedules are used to amend a 2024 California resident tax return?

All Answers 1

Answered by GPT-5 mini AI
To amend a California resident (Form 540) tax return you generally must file:

- Form 540X — Amended Individual Income Tax Return (California). This is the main amended-return form.

And attach:
- A corrected Form 540 (or a copy of the original Form 540 with corrected amounts clearly shown) that reflects the changes.
- Schedule CA (540) — California Adjustments — Residents, if any federal-to-state adjustments or AGI changes are involved.
- Any California schedules or forms that changed because of the amendment (common examples: Schedule D (540) for capital gains/losses, Schedule P (540) for alternative minimum tax, and any credit or withholding schedules).
- A copy of your federal amended return (Form 1040-X) and any changed federal schedules, if the amendment results from a federal change.
- Documentation that supports the changes (W-2s, 1099s, receipts, statements, court orders, etc.) and a short explanation of the reason for the amendment.

Other notes:
- Follow the Form 540X instructions for signing, filing address, and whether you must mail the amended return or can e-file (check the current FTB guidance).
- If you owe additional tax, include payment or arrange payment to avoid penalties and interest.
